G75 power adapter is dead

yyz668
Level 7
My G75 power adapter just died on me. The green LED on the brick doesn't light up whenever i plug it into an outlet. I've had the laptop since June of last year and I was wondering what options do i have about replacing it. Can i get a replacement for free if I'm still under warranty or will I have to buy a new one? Any help would be appreciated. Thanks.

It sounds like your laptop is still within the ASUS Warranty (most are covered for 1 year). The Warranty should cover the power adapter.

One last question, will I have to send in the whole laptop or just the ac adapter? Thanks

rewben
Level 13
if you have an asus service center near your place, a better option is to call them first to set up an appointment to collect the adapter; they will place an order and let you know when to collect.

if not, send a message via vip.asus.com and ask if you really need to do that.
